#33761d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33761d is composed of 20% red, 46.3%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 28.8%. #33761d color hex could be obtained by blending #66ec3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#33761d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33761d has RGB values of R:51, G:118,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 3372573.

Shades and Tints of #33761d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030802 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#33761d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474e45 is the less saturated color, while #259201 is the most saturated one.
